    You open the door to a caller after dark when you are not expecting anyone? Why?

    If it's someone you don't know, send them away (as in just ask through the door "who is it" -- "package for so and so" -- "please come back during normal daylight hours, thanks" -- or "leave a will call slip so I can arrange to pick it up tomorrow, thanks . . . ). If they won't go, well then things get different.

    Where I am a common enough scam is "I accidentally locked myself out of my house; can I use your phone" type BS (lots of variations, but that's the basic idea -- usually they want to start talking with you, gain your confidence and then ask for money to get someplace where their "spare keys are" (yeah, right) -- generally harmless but you never know). I just answer through the door, "sure, I'll get the police for you and they will help you." Never actually had to call the police to "help" them before they just ran away.
